An Examination of Binder Systems and Their Influences on Burn Rates of High‐Nitrogen Containing Formulations
Authors:Jesse J. Sabatini  Cathleen T. Freeman  Jay C. Poret  Amita V. Nagori  Gary Chen
Abstract:The examination of Laminac 4116/Lupersol and Epon 813/Versamid 140 binder systems, and their influences on burn rates of pyrotechnic formulations is described. Laminac 4116/Lupersol‐based formulations had shorter burn times and larger heat of explosion values compared to their Epon 813/Versamid 140 counterparts. An understanding of the chemical structures and approximate oxygen balances of these binder systems served to explain their burn time differences when used in pyrotechnic formulations. Bomb calorimetry of Laminac 4116/Lupersol‐ and Epon 813/Versamid 140‐based formulations provided heat of explosion values to further explain the burn time differences of the two binder systems used.
